OFFICIAL PRESS RELEASE FROM THE SPOKANE COUNTY SHERIFF'S OFFICE: Unincorporated Spokane County saw an increase in the number of
residential burglaries reported to the Sheriff's Office through the first and
second quarters of 2012.
Recognizing these numbers were significantly higher
than the same time frames in 2010 and 2011, the Sheriff restructured personnel
to combat this increase which proved extremely successful.
Hundreds of arrests and charges were not only the result of
restructuring personnel, but also the result of community involvement
continuously providing the Sheriff's Office with vital information that led to a
large majority of these arrests.
As a result of this combined effort, third
quarter residential burglaries in unincorporated Spokane County were the lowest
they have been since the first quarter of 2010.
The Sheriff's Office encourages
the continued assistance of the citizens of Spokane County with providing
information that assists in reducing all crime rates in our community.
